🥘 Ingredients

16 items
  • 1.5 cups all-purpose flour
  • 0.75 cups granulated sugar
  • 1.5 teaspoons baking powder
  • 0.25 teaspoons salt
  • 0.5 cups unsalted butter
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 tablespoon lemon zest
  • 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 0.5 cups whole milk
  • 1 cup fresh cranberries (halved)
  • 1.5 cups powdered sugar
  • 0.25 cups unsalted butter (softened, for frosting)
  • 4 ounces cream cheese (softened, for frosting)
  • 1 teaspoon lemon zest (for frosting)
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ice (for frosting)

📝 Instructions

13 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a 12-cup muffin tin with cupcake liners.

2

In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t. Set aside.

3

In a large bowl, use a hand or stand mixer to cream the butter until smooth and fluffy, about 2-3 minutes.

4

Add the eggs, one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Then mix in the lemon zest, lemon juice, and vanilla extract.

5

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, alternating with the milk, beginning and ending with the dry mixture. Mix until just combined.

6

Gently fold in the halved cranberries, ensuring they are evenly distributed throughout the batter.

7

Spoon the batter into the prepared cupcake liners, filling each about 3/4 full.

8

Bake in the preheated oven for 18-20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.

9

Remove the cupcakes from the oven and let them cool in the pan for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.

10

To make the frosting, beat the softened butter and cream cheese together in a medium bowl until smooth and creamy.

11

Gradually add the powdered sugar, mixing until fully combined. Then mix in the lemon zest and lemon juice until the frosting is smooth and fluffy.

12

Once the cupcakes are completely cool, pipe or spread the frosting onto the cupcakes.

13

Optionally, garnish with a sprinkle of lemon zest or a few fresh cranberries for a festive touch. Serve and enjoy!
